WARNING:

  Shut  off  the  power  supply  before 

removing  or  replacing  lamp.    In  handling  of 

halogen bulb, care should be taken not to touch 

it with your bare hands.  Oil residue will shorten 

the life of the halogen bulb.  If you accidentally 

come into contact, wipe thoroughly with a clean, 

lint-free, cotton cloth before installing.  Allow the 

bulb to cool off before changing the bulb.  Use 

light bulb in accordance with the fan's specifica-

tion.   

REDUCE THE  RISK OF FIRE  DO NOT 

EXCEED MAXIMUM WATTAGE  RATING.

Remove 1 of 3 screws from the mounting plate 

and  loosen  the  other  2  screws(Do  not 

remove). (Fig 16)

Connect white wire from motor to white wire 

from  light  kit  plate.  Connect  black  wire  from 

motor to black wire from light kit plate.

Place key holes on the light kit plate over the 2 

screws previously loosened from the mounting 

plate, turn light kit plate until it locks in place at 

the narrow setion of the key holes.Secure by 

tightening  2  screws  previously  loosened  and 

the one previously removed. (Fig 16)
